Experience

  • Preparation of initial drafts of wills, trusts and other estate planning documents
  • Administration of insurance trusts
  • Maintenance of library of estate planning forms for practice group
  • Preparation and filing of probate forms for probate, guardianship, conservatorship proceedings in Probate Court
  • Collation of information for federal estate tax returns
  • Handling transfers of assets to beneficiaries
  • Preparation of fiduciary accounts
  • Drafting petitions and other probate pleadings
